Output 173439637bfbbba901c54252a6fe56c97ab57288b1e0404c43cc497c090d6b29:0

value
9837241
script pubkey
OP_0 OP_PUSHBYTES_20 28685cd8e24897ba52b1a42bc72c5fb07f2585b2
address
bc1q9p59ek8zfztm55435s4uwtzlkpljtpdjtt2lz0
transaction
173439637bfbbba901c54252a6fe56c97ab57288b1e0404c43cc497c090d6b29
confirmations
127110
spent
true